WebApr 6, 2024 · While you are painting, have a jar of water with you and simply dip your brushes into the water. This will stop the acrylic paint from building up and resulting in damage to the brushes’ bristles. Dip the brush in the water, swirl it around, and you will see the paint simply dissolve. WebAug 24, 2024 · How do you clean and restore an oil painting? The easiest way to remove a thin layer of dust, grime or residue is with a soft cloth and soapy water. Due to its low pH level and mild properties, olive oil-based soap is often considered the most effective soap to use. Make sure you don’t use anything that contains alcohol as this could remove ... Web1 day ago · With the sink out of bounds, you're probably wondering where to turn. Well, the most basic (and slightly rudimentary) solution is a bucket. 'Wash the brush using a five-gallon bucket filled with water, add dish soap, and then use a second five-gallon bucket for rinse water,' advises Matt Kunz, President of Five Star Painting, a Neighborly company.
